By &c
Whereas we intend that the Ship you command together with His Majts Ship Proteus which will be ordered to call off Plymouth to join you & whose Commr Capt Robinson will be directed to obey Your Orders, Shall proceed forthwith into the River St Lawrence with such Transports Storeships, Victuallers & Trade bound thither as he may bring with him from Spithead and with any other Ships or Vessels which may be ready & willing to accompany you So soon therefore as the Proteus arrives which you will know by her Commr hoisting a Jack at her Foretop Gallant Mast head; You are hereby required & directed to put to Sea & taking the said Ship under your command & such Transports Victuallers & Trade as are abovementioned under your Convoy make the best of your way consistent with their security with them into the River St Lawrence and having seen them as far as the Isle of Bic, you are to direct Capt Robinson to proceed to Quebec with the Ships & Vessels going thither &upon his arrival there to Deliver the inclosed Pacquet to the Senior Captain for the time being of His Majs Ships & Vessels in the abovementioned River & follow his orders for his further proceedings, And you are to make the best of your way in ~he Ship you command to New York (calling however at some convenient 1Place in your way to Wood & Water if you find it necessary) when you are to deliver to Vice Adml Ld Visct Howe the Pacquet you will also receive herewith addressed to him, And putting yourself under his Lordships Command follow his orders for your further proceedings.
You are to be very attentive to the Ships & Vessels which proceed under your Convoy; keeping them together by every means in your Power and upon no Account leaving them upon pretence of their not sailing fast enough to keep Company with You as we expect that in the course of your Voyage you accomodate Your progress to that of .the worst sailing Sailing Ship amongst them
You are at the same time to take all possible care to prevent the said Ships & Vessels from separating from you, and to give their respective Masters such Orders & directions as you judge most conducive to that end, And in case (notwithstanding these precautions) any of them shall part Company with you or disobey your Orders You are to transmit to our Secretary a List of their Names with the circumstances attending such seperation, And disobedience that such measures may be taken thereupon as shall be judged necessary. Given &c 1st May 1777
Capt Mackenzie ー Lizard ー Plymo
